Why Your Resume Objective Matters

A resume objective is a concise statement that highlights your career goals, skills, and what you can
bring to the table for prospective employers. It serves as a snapshot of your professional identity,
helping recruiters understand your intentions and qualifications at a glance. A well-crafted objective
can make your resume stand out in a sea of applications, increasing your chances of landing that
coveted interview.
